    I was out of work last yr and owe back child support,will the IRS take my husbands taxes to pay this debt that I Owe?

    We have only been married for 11 months.

    Yes IF you state is aware of the arrearage..  The Internal Revenue Code Section 6402(c) allows the Department of Treasury and the IRS to use a taxpayer's refunds to offset delinquent child support arrearages.


    The Department of Treasury offsets tax refunds by disclosing taxpayerss refund information to state Office of Child Support Enforcement agencies. The state agencies use the IRS's information to verify the taxpayer does not owe child support payments to its residents.
